The Art of the Hand Forged Kukri
The creation of a hand hammered kukri is far past simple blacksmithing . It’s a time-honored art form, transmitted through generations of skilled makers in the Himalayan region. The method begins with selecting superior steel , typically salvaged materials in some cases, and then carefully warming it in a charcoal forge. The edge is then lengthened and molded using a series of hammer blows , a skilled dance between the craftsman and the iron . This demanding procedure demands immense experience and a thorough understanding of material science . The sweep of the steel is crucial, impacting both its handling and its effectiveness as a weapon . Following the shaping phase, the blade undergoes thorough tempering and finishing to achieve its final sharpness and resilience .

Forging Steel: Creating a Custom Knife
The art of forging your custom knife is remarkable skill and dedication. It commences with choosing the perfect type of alloy – often high-carbon varieties like 1095 or O1. Warming the raw material to the forging point – typically around 2000°F – allows the blacksmith to form it with hammers and various techniques. The shaping method may involve techniques like extending the piece and establishing the particular profile. Further steps entail tempering the steel to reduce brittleness , then accurately refining the blade to achieve the sharpness necessary for the purpose. To conclude, the scales will be attached – frequently from wood like stabilized wood or composite – ending the construction of a truly one-of-a-kind knife.
